接口开放平台的产品设计脑图及解决方案

简介: 接口开放平台的产品设计脑图及解决方案

接口开放平台

出于下游客户和开发者需要调用API和进行数据自动化对接的需求,当企业需要对外开放API接口时,就需要搭建自己的接口开放平台,并向外部开发者提供OpenAPI。

产品设计脑图

结合前面分享的文章:自建API接口管理平台的产品解决方案,本次继续分享在接口开放平台的产品设计脑图及其解决方案。

API开放平台脑图如下(点击图片可以查看高清原图):

API开放平台的设计脑图

按产品优先级划分,API开放平台所需要具备的功能模块主要有:

核心领域的:登录注册、应用管理、接口权限、接口文档

支持领域的:服务大厅、流量统计、首页

通用领域的:个人中心、工单管理

开放平台的使用说明

从外部开发者的角度,当开发者需要使用开放平台时,一般需要经历以下三个阶段。

第一阶段,引导开发者自助注册,开通账号。

第二阶段,引导开发者创建应用,申请接口权限。

第三阶段,开发者根据API接口规范,查看、接入和调用所需要的API接口。

可以在开放平台的首页给予新人引导,例如:

另外,在开发文档时,再配套提供更简洁的接入流程说明。例如下图:

登录注册

对于开放平台,开发者可以选择自行注册和登录。

注册时,可以选择不同的开发者角色,以便后续进行按角色分配接口权限,方便管理。

创建应用

开发者成功注册后,需要先申请和创建他的应用。开发者应用是指调用API接口的程序、系统和终端。成功创建和申请应用后,将会得到app_key和密钥。

查看接口文档和调用API

在登录的情况下,进入开放平台后,开发者可以查看自己每个应用所开通的API接口权限。

也可以在未登录的情况下,以游客的身份查看开放接口的在线接口文档,提前了解开放平台具备、提供和开放了哪些API接口服务能力。

在具体的API接口文档,开发者可以查看每个API接口的名称、功能描述、接口路径、接口参数和返回等信息。

购买付费API

如果某些API接口需要付费开通后才能使用,开发者需要能先查看每个接口的服务套餐,进行在线下单,和查看成功购买后的接口服务包,以及流量消耗情况。最好能在余额不足时及时提醒开发者。

接口流量统计和账单

最后,再配套为开发者提供接口调用的账单统计。

目录
打赏
0
0
0
0
1
分享
相关文章
产品经理视角 | API接口知识小结
应用程序接口API(Application Programming Interface),是提供特定业务输出能力、连接不同系统的一种约定。这里包括外部系统与提供服务的系统(中后台系统)或后台不同系统之间的交互点。包括外部接口、内部接口,内部接口又包括:上层服务与下层服务接口、同级接口。
钉钉文档协同编辑背后的核心技术原理
有人说,互联网给人类社会带来最深层次的变革是改变了人与人协作的方式,将信息传播的成本大幅降低。身在互联网行业之中,研究信息传播的方式方法,是我们的日常功课。
钉钉文档协同编辑背后的核心技术原理
《智能导购 AI 助手构建》解决方案评测:极具吸引力的产品,亟待完善的教程文档
《智能导购 AI 助手构建》解决方案评测:极具吸引力的产品,亟待完善的教程文档
187 8
《智能导购 AI 助手构建》解决方案评测:极具吸引力的产品,亟待完善的教程文档
视觉智能开放平台产品使用合集之是否有专门提供编辑器实现方案
视觉智能开放平台是指提供一系列基于视觉识别技术的API和服务的平台,这些服务通常包括图像识别、人脸识别、物体检测、文字识别、场景理解等。企业或开发者可以通过调用这些API,快速将视觉智能功能集成到自己的应用或服务中,而无需从零开始研发相关算法和技术。以下是一些常见的视觉智能开放平台产品及其应用场景的概览。
养鱼玩法元宇宙平台合约开发源码详情
function createFish(address player, FishType type) public returns (uint index) { Fish memory fish = Fish({ type: type, level: 1, experience: 0 });
千帆大模型平台多维度体验总结——平台使用以及接口调用小游戏开发
千帆大模型平台多维度体验总结——平台使用以及接口调用小游戏开发
380 0
我在平台与 AIGC 的交互组件一些设计经验
这里阐述以平台运营为主,这里假设说已经有一个平台,包括技术、数据、运维、管理、运营等基础设施的能力。 这个设计原来主要的问题是超自动化的提升,结合 LLM 为了更好的实现,在这个过程中,也包含了一些自主的感知和学习的能力,带有智能体的一定的特征。在前期的研究中也是不断的查看和摸索了很多的开源项目,包括一出来就热门的 Github 项目,但在使用遇到的情况更多的是还只是属于一些例子或者带有很多不稳定因素,并没有说见到能达到较稳定的层面。
自动驾驶技术平台分享:百度Apollo开放平台8.0再升级,更简单,更便捷,更高效
自动驾驶技术平台分享:百度Apollo开放平台8.0再升级,更简单,更便捷,更高效
自动驾驶技术平台分享:百度Apollo开放平台8.0再升级,更简单,更便捷,更高效